Physician Assistant Veteran Disability Assessments (Part-Time No On-Call)


Panama City FL 2 Days/Week 8:00 AM4:30 PM

Tired of chasing prior auths and squeezing in a full patient panel between callbacks This role offers something different: a focused evaluation-based position where your clinical judgment is the job not just part of it.

The IMA Group is hiring a Physician Assistant to conduct independent medical evaluations for Veterans pursuing disability benefits tied to service-connected conditions. Youll bring your diagnostic skills to a structured assessment-only environment no ongoing management no treatment plans no after-hours pages.

Core Responsibilities

  • Perform detailed physical exams and gather medical histories
  • Analyze medical records imaging and diagnostic results
  • Apply VA disability evaluation standards to your findings
  • Draft objective well-supported reports linking conditions to military service
  • Submit documentation through our digital case platform

Qualifications

  • Active unrestricted Physician Assistant license in Florida
  • Graduate of an accredited PA program
  • NCCPA certification in good standing
  • Solid clinical background with strong diagnostic reasoning
  • Experience in Family Medicine Internal Medicine Emergency Medicine Occupational Health Orthopedics or PM&R is a plus

The IMA Group Difference

  • Steady predictable 2-day schedule
  • Daytime hours only 8:00 AM to 4:30 PM
  • No on-call rotation
  • No patient panel or continuity-of-care burden
  • Work centered entirely on evaluation and clinical documentation

Our Government Services Division supports local state and federal agencies and delivers professional and objective medical and psychological examinations as well as ancillary services. Our Payer Services Division meets the evaluation and screening needs of Carriers TPAs Public Entities and Employers and includes behavioral health and physical medicine specialty services working with a wide range of organizations within the workers compensation disability liability and auto markets. Our Clinical Research Division performs all types of Phase II-IV clinical trials in multiple therapeutic areas through a flexible nationwide network of site locations and virtual capabilities.
